The build logs stream like falling rain, and your Minimum Viable Product takes shape in Red Hat OpenShift before you can blink. Speed matters. MVP OpenShift workflows cut waste, reduce setup time, and give teams the power to push code from idea to production in hours, not weeks.

OpenShift brings container orchestration, Kubernetes integration, and developer-friendly automation into one platform. For an MVP, this means you can deploy fast, iterate quickly, and gather user feedback while competitors are still writing deployment scripts. Build pipelines handle CI/CD with security policies baked in. Operators simplify scaling by managing stateful applications without manual intervention.

An MVP on OpenShift benefits from consistent environments. Local builds match production clusters. Dependency management stays clean. Resource quotas keep runaway processes from burning your budget. OpenShift’s web console and CLI give you control over deployments, rollbacks, and monitoring without slowing the release cycle.

Using OpenShift for MVP development also delivers enterprise-grade reliability from day one. You get automatic failover, load balancing, and self-healing containers. This makes even early-stage builds stable enough for real traffic and measurable user engagement.

The MVP OpenShift path is direct: define your app in a container image, choose a deployment configuration, and integrate with your build pipeline. OpenShift’s templates and YAML definitions make the process predictable and repeatable. Once running, you can connect route definitions to expose your service publicly, test endpoints, and watch metrics flow in real time.
